for循环的标准定义格式是: for (初始化条件 ; 判断条件 ; 控制条件) { 循环体 }但是,还有一种比较少见的定义形式,类似于while的格式,具体如下
初始化条件;
for ( ; 判断条件 ; 控制条件) {
循环体语句 ;
}
代码举例:
求1-10的和
class Demo {
public static void main(String[]args){
int x=1;
int sum=0;
for (;x<=10 ;x++ ) {
sum+=x;
}
System.out.println("1-10相加的和为"+sum);
}
}
这一种格式,和while的格式极为类似,而且控制条件控制的变量在循环结束后,也能继续被访问.
但是这个格式使用较少.
|
|